Dec 2, 2023 · Depending on the type of oil you choose, the recommended oil change intervals may vary. Synthetic oil typically allows for longer intervals between changes, often ranging from 7,500 to 10,000 miles. Conventional oil, on the other hand, may require more frequent changes, typically every 3,000 to 5,000 miles. Synthetic bland oil should be changed every 7,500 miles in most cars. Some makes and models, however, require owners to change the oil more or less often. Engine failure: Extending your oil drain interval can lead to engine damage and possibly failure. An engine is designed to consume or lose a little bit of oil over time. Over a period of time, the motor oil in your engine can thicken and lose volume. This can lead to engine damage due to improper lubrication or oil starvation.

It would be best if you had your oil changed as soon as ...Some will recommend around a 7,000 mile interval, others as much as 10,000 or 13,000 miles. A study at GM (who usually recommends around an 8,000 mile interval) found that a vehicle could go as long as 17,000 miles between oil changes without significantly degrading the oil.
